Car Seat and Stroller Combos
The most reliable car seat stroller combos are so easy to attach that it's like they're doing it all by themselves. Stanton advises: "Look for a base that is simple to click with the carrier." This reduces the chance of errors that can happen when assembling and detaching.
Doona is one option that lets you accomplish this. It easily converts from a car seat to stroller, and makes space in your trunk. Reviewers on the internet love the Doona's features and user-friendliness, but they also praise its robust feel.
Easy to Assemble
Parents who do not want to switch between car seats and strollers often find a mix of both attractive. It's also an ideal choice for those who often use rideshares or public transportation as well as those who switch between caregivers. Stanton says that because they're a single piece and the wheels are attached, the car seats are more mobile. Stanton says it is important to secure the car seat correctly when using the travel system. Always follow the manufacturer's instructions and the owner's manual for your vehicle to ensure that the seat is secure she advises.
In our tests, the best stroller-car seat combos have simple click-in connections, which requires little effort, other than moving the car seat from one location to another. These models scored higher compared to models with more complicated connections due to the fact that they require less pressure and offer fewer chances for errors, whether deliberate or accidental. For example, we like the fact that the UPPAbaby Vista Combo has a simple drop-in attachment that has no straps--and that there's an indicator on the base of the car seat that shows when it is level.
The Doona All in-One Infant Car Seat Stroller too, is easy to set up and move from car to stroller. It's a seamless conversion that lets you to use the extra space in your trunk to go for shopping or running errands. It also features an adjustable front wheel that provides great maneuverability, even when the seat is in place.
Another option is the Britax B-Lively and B-Safe Gen2 Travel System that has springy suspension and an enormous, one-hand-folding chassis for easy storage. It comes with a large storage basket as well as plenty of cup holders to hold drinks, snacks and baby pushchair 2 in 1 equipment. Its padded seat is comfortable for long rides and the tagless smooth-touch fabric is machine washable. It's FAA-approved and comes with an safety harness that is secured at or below your baby's shoulders and includes a SafeCell crumple zone to protect your child in the event of an accident.
A good travel system should be easy to push. Our top picks have rubber tires and a single rotating wheel at the front to help navigate busy sidewalks and streets. The Thule Urban Glide 2 in 1 prams Combo and the BOB Alterrain Pro are all easy-gliding and come with useful features such as one-hand brake and a large storage basket.

Easy to Fold
Car seat and stroller combos are an excellent option for parents who need one piece of baby equipment which can perform multiple functions. They are able to easily switch from being a car seat to a stroller and then back to a car seat, and are usually easier to maneuver than two-piece travel systems. "They're designed to be more natural-looking and mobile," says Stanton. "They contain fewer moving parts, making them easier to fold, use, and carry."
These strollers and car seats for infants are also lighter than two-piece models and can be easily carried in trunks that are small. These strollers and infant car seats are generally lighter and come with more useful features, like sun shades and cup holders. Some models even have a swivel wheel on the front that's great for navigating crowded sidewalks and stores.
Certain brands, such as Doona offer a stroller as well as an infant car seats that can be used together. They are particularly useful for parents who take rideshares or public transportation, or who change caregivers frequently. This model is basically a rear-facing car seat on wheels. The wheels can be lowered to become a stroller when you wish to use it.
Other brands, like the Evenflo Shyft DualRide, allow you to click on the car seat and then fold it up into the form of a stroller. This model isn't as sleek as Doona but you can remove the car seat without needing to click into its base.
Check if the stroller and infant seat combination you are considering can accommodate your preferred car seat. If it's compatible, you can expect to get a longer life out of the product since it will continue to be able to work with your child once they are no longer in the infant car seat.
It's also important to be aware that some stroller and car seat combos don't perform well in our tests of ease-of-use. This could be because of a design which makes it difficult to climb stairs or because the weight and size of the stroller/car seat can make it more difficult to push.
